What does it mean to have a Registered Agent?
A legal representative is an entity or company designated to receive official notices and government communications on behalf of a company. This crucial role ensures that a company is properly notified of significant legal matters, such as legal actions, tax-related notifications, and compliance requirements. By serving as a point of contact, a registered agent facilitates sustain the company's status and ensures smooth communication with government officials.
In the context of different types of business entities, such as limited liability companies and corporate entities, the legal representative can either an person or a commercial registered agent service. Many companies choose to engage a professional registered agent to ensure they meet all legal requirements and timelines. This decision helps to protect the business owner's privacy and mitigate the risks associated with overlooking crucial notices.

Benefits of Using a Designated Agent
Engaging a registered agent provides essential legal support for businesses, ensuring that significant documents are delivered in a prompt manner. additional information registered agent service acts as a trustworthy point of contact for your corporation or business, handling vital paperwork such as legal notices, financial documents, and compliance reminders. This support assists you maintain organization and ensures that you avoid missing a major deadline, which can lead to costly penalties or legal troubles.
Another important benefit of using a registered agent is the privacy it offers. By choosing a designated agent, business owners can remove their private addresses off government files, reducing the risk of unwanted solicitations or threats. This level of confidentiality allows business owners to concentrate on expanding their business without the persistent disruption of work-related calls at their private properties.

Pricing of Registered Agent Services
When analyzing the pricing of registered agent services, it is important to recognize that pricing can change significantly based on elements such as the company, the quality of service provided, and the area. Typically, contracting a registered agent service for an corporation can be between $50 to $300 per year. Some providers may give cheaper options with limited services, while others deliver comprehensive packages that offer additional benefits like compliance alerts and file scanning.

Legal Requirements and Adherence
As you prepare to launch a enterprise, understanding the regulatory necessities surrounding designated representatives is important. Each state mandates that companies and LLCs designate a agent to accept legal notices and maintain conformity with state laws. This requirement is part of ensuring clarity and trustworthiness in commercial activities. A registered agent must have a physical address within the state of incorporation and be accessible during official hours to accept essential notifications.
Compliance with registered agent responsibilities varies further than just designation. Businesses must update their agent information up to date with state agencies to steer clear of sanctions. Failing to notify appropriate bodies about changes or having an inaccessible agent can endanger a enterprise's position. Utilizing a dependable agent service can assist ensure compliance and ensure that official communications are correctly processed and documented.
